Sr. Associate III, Surgical General Field Sales & Account Management (P)(Professional Path), is primarily responsible for managing local accounts and mentoring a small team. You will build and extend relationships with key Surgical accounts to achieve sales targets, develop customer strategies, and create action plans aligned with account objectives. Specifics include:
• Manage local account relationships, often leading a small team or specific accounts
• Foster and maintain long-term business relationships with key accounts to achieve sales targets and understand customer challenges
• Drive sales, promotion, and development in designated accounts to meet commercial goals
• Create customer development strategies and dedicated account management action plans
• Expand relationships with existing customers by proposing solutions that meet their needs
• Lead the sales operations plan to achieve sales and performance targets
• Prepare strategies and tactical plans, providing strategic input for accounts
• Prepare and negotiate contracts, guiding company initiatives for targeted accounts
• Analyze market situations, including competitive intelligence on key accounts and competitors
• Contribute to stakeholder mapping, segmentation, and profiling, providing data for the Alcon Customer Relationship Management system
• Organize customer events and programs with marketing/medical departments
• Promote and sell products across multiple sales channels
• Establish and implement a sales/business plan for a designated client base
• Mentor and coach junior sales associates, developing an effective sales team through training and coaching
